Vidcast:  https://www.instagram.com/p/DQdmkOKCSjm/The Brits now tell us that they have some better remedies for the world’s constipation woes and they don’t include high fiber diets or harsh laxatives. A new meta-analysis from the nutritionists at King’s College, London rigorously reviewed 75 clinical trials and gives us some better suggestions for constipation relief.When the data were crunched, it showed significant constipation relief from kiwifruit, rye bread, and mineral rich water.  Also helpful were dietary supplements containing psyllium fiber, probiotics, and magnesium oxide. These suggestions are now endorsed by the British Dietetic Association.  If you continue to suffer from hard, infrequent stools, why not give them a try.  As you do, remember that enough daily water is critical for regular defecation.  For adult men, that number is 125 oz and for women 91 oz.  We parents do know that kiddies too can become constipated. The magic number for toddlers is 44 oz, for older children 57 oz, for young teen boys 81 oz, for girls 71 oz, for older teen boys 112 oz, for girls 78 oz.  For everyone, the water requirements surge with hot weather, exercise, fever, diarrhea, and breastfeeding.https://onlinelibrary.wiley.com/doi/10.1111/nmo.70173https://nap.nationalacademies.org/read/11537/chapter/15#constipation #fiber #laxatives  #water #grains #fruit
